The idea is to make the holiday feel special, not just like any other day. So, I decided that I was going to try this. Make Thanksgiving dinner at least look special, since it was just the 5 of us for dinner. ;( Here's my 1st attempt. Total cost: $8

Tall vases-$1 each, Green plates-$1/4, pumpkins and gourds-$.50 each
Had: lemons, candles,ribbon, wine glasses

I took wine glasses, turned them upside down, put lemons in the bottom, and a candle on the top.

I took ribbon and just wound it around the vases, plates, and glasses.
Colors: Rose, Yellow, Olive, and Orange
